Why You’ll Love Sugar-Free Desserts
Suddenly cutting sugar doesn’t mean sacrificing sweets. Sugar-free desserts are crafted using natural or artificial alternatives that mimic sugar’s richness without the drawbacks. You get:
- Lower glycemic impact – Ideal for stable energy and blood sugar control
- Natural sweetness – Using alternatives like stevia, monk fruit, or fiber-based sweeteners
- Indulgence without guilt – Satisfy sweet cravings the healthy way
- Delicious texture – Recipes crafted to replicate fudgy, creamy, or crunchy perfection
1. Rich Chocolate Mousse with Coconut Cream

The ultimate sugar-free luxury: This silky chocolate mousse is rich, velvety, and deeply satisfying. Made with high-quality dark chocolate swapped for sugar and whipped coconut cream, it’s enhanced with a touch of vanilla bean and stevia. No dairy? Use vegan coconut cream for a dairy-free version.
Perfect for: post-dinner servings or solo cravings.
Quick Tip: Chill for at least 2 hours for a firmer texture.

3. Oatmeal Chocolate Chip Cookies (No Added Sugar)
Swap white flour, sugar, and butter for rolled oats, mashed ripe bananas, chia seeds, and almond butter. Bake until golden, and recook any leftover nuts into a sweet sprinkle for texture. These cookies are chewy, sweet, and satisfying — all without refined sugar!
Health Bonus: Oats and chia provide fiber and healthy fats that keep you full longer.
4. Berry Greek Yogurt Parfait
Layer creamy, unsweetened Greek yogurt with fresh or frozen berries and a sprinkle of coconut flakes. Sweeten naturally with a drizzle of monk fruit syrup or a spoonful of date paste. Top with crushed walnuts or almonds for crunch.
Vibe: Like a fruit parfait dipped in dessert — light, fresh, and packed with antioxidants.
